Transaction 965d9376b88fd077c15d2d80859a180f90515d827b0e8b4bc07127b2ae249fe6
1 Input
1 Output
-
965d9376b88fd077c15d2d80859a180f90515d827b0e8b4bc07127b2ae249fe6:0
- value
- 10575036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55ba84efe3139117e2a03b9943f863106f510fef OP_EQUAL
- address
- 39WJoSGb6VaDFAKy8skqB9vfirWdwjkBWG